    Future Generali Car Insurance Claim Process

    The Future Generali car insurance claim process is quick and hassle-free. You can either make a cashless or a reimbursement claim depending on your convenience at the time of the mishap.

    • In case of a Cashless Claim:
      • Inform the insurer as soon as the mishap takes place and register your cashless claim request. To register your claim, call on 1800-220-233/1860-500-3333/022-67837800 or email to fgcare@futuregenerali.in or message MOTORCLAIM to 9222211100
      • Once the insurer registers your claim, an authorised Surveyor will be sent to conduct a vehicle inspection and assess the loss/damages incurred
      • Submit the relevant documents to the surveyor as requested by the customer care executive
      • The insurer after verifying the documents will approve a claim amount that will be communicated to the garage where you will be taking your car for repair
      • Once your car is repaired, the insurer will pay the garage directly for the repair work
    • In case of a Reimbursement Claim:
      • Inform the insurer as soon as the mishap takes place and register your cashless claim request. To register your claim, call on 1800-220-233/1860-500-3333/022-67837800 or email to fgcare@futuregenerali.in or message MOTORCLAIM to 9222211100
      • Once the insurer registers your claim, an authorised Surveyor will be sent to conduct a vehicle inspection and assess the loss/damages incurred
      • Submit the relevant documents to the surveyor as requested
      • After your car is repaired, you have to directly pay the garage for the repair work.
      • Collect the payment receipt and invoice from the garage and submit them to the insurer to get the amount you spent on the repairs reimbursed
      • The insurer will reimburse the amount within 7 working days after verifying the submitted documents

    To be submitted:

    Depending on the kind of liability you have incurred due to the mishap, there are certain documents and/or things to be submitted and details to be provided while processing your claim.

    • Own Damage claims
      • Insurance Certificate (original and xerox copy)
      • Claim form duly Filled and signed by you
      • The vehicle’s Registration Certificate (original and xerox copy)
      • Your Driving License (original and xerox copy)
      • Loss estimate as provided by the garage mechanic
      • Pan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)
      • Aadhar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)
    • Third Party Claims
      • Claim form duly filled and signed by you
      • Insurance Certificate (original and xerox copy)
      • Driving License of the person driving the vehicle at the time of the mishap (original and xerox copy)
      • Copy of the FIR filed by you
      • Copy of the Court Notice
      • The vehicle’s Registration Certificate (original and xerox copy)
      • Pan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)
      • Aadhar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)
    • Theft Claims
      • Insurance Policy Document (original and xerox copy)
      • Claim form duly filled and signed by you (original and xerox copy)
      • The vehicle’s Registration certificate (original and xerox copy)
      • Copy of the FIR filed by you
      • The original set of car keys
      • Sales invoice (original and xerox copy)
      • Tax payment receipt (original and xerox copy)
      • Copy of the letter sent to the RTO intimating about the stolen vehicle
      • Vehicle transfer papers
      • Letter of Indemnity
      • Letter of Subrogation
      • Pan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)
      • Aadhar Card of the policyholder (original and xerox copy)

    Xpress and Future Xpress+

    Future Generali has introduced *Future Xpress and *Future Xpress+ which are claim processes for a speedy and hassle-free claim settlement.

    • *Future Xpress Under Future Xpress, you can get your car repaired on priority for low repair costs at Future Generali authorised garages.
    • *Future Xpress+ Under Future Xpress+ you can have your damaged car checked at any of the Future Generali authorised garages to get the loss estimate and on the spot claim settlement. You can also opt to have your car repaired at a time convenient to you and at a garage of your choice. *The above-mentioned services are available only at selected garages/offices and applicable for claims with defined parameters alone.

    Exclusions of Future Generali Car Insurance

    The Future Generali car insurance claim process will not be applicable under the following circumstances:

    • If the person driving the vehicle was under the influence of alcohol/drugs
    • If the person was underage and/or didn’t have a valid driver’s licence
    • If a personal vehicle was being used for commercial purposes and vice-versa
    • If the mishap took place outside of the specified geographical location
    • Electrical/mechanical failure
    • Damage/loss due to wars or nuclear risks or mutiny
    • If the insurance policy has expired

    Future Generali Car Insurance FAQs:

    1. What should be done if the vehicle meets with an accident outside of the specified geographical location?

    2. Get in touch with your insurer as soon as the mishap takes place. In case you are unable to contact the insurer for some reason, take photographs of your vehicle on the spot of the mishap. File an FIR at the nearest police station too.

    3. Can I renew my car insurance policy after it expires?

    4. In case your insurance policy expires, you can still renew it after the insurer has completed your vehicle’s inspection. You might also be charged an additional premium if the insurance policy expired 45 days ago.

    5. What does a third-party car insurance policy cover?

    6. A third-party car insurance policy covers the liabilities arising from the following:

      • Injuries/death to the third party involved in the mishap
      • Damages to the third party vehicle involved in the mishap
      • Damages to external property due to the mishap
    7. What does a comprehensive car insurance policy cover?

    8. A comprehensive car insurance policy covers the following:

      • Liabilities due to injuries/damage to the third party
      • Liabilities due to vehicle damage to the third-party vehicle
      • Liabilities due to external property damage
      • Liabilities due to own injuries
      • Liabilities due to own vehicle damages
    9. What if I install a CNG/LPG kit in my vehicle?

      In case you install a CNG/LPG kit in your vehicle, you need to inform the RTO as well as the insurer as this needs to be noted in your insurance policy and you will be charged an additional premium for the same.
